Crap Detector: Olivia Munn non-nude Playboy pictorial reeks of shameless self-promotion

Geek godess Olivia Munn is now a Playboy cover girl.

Gamer fantasy gal Olivia Munn is now a Playboy cover girl.

If you’re a gamer/techie, Olivia Munn should be a familiar face, especially for regular viewers of Attack of the Show, a program for the G4 cable channel. Olivia is one of the better-looking hosts of G4, so it wouldn’t be a surprise to see her move up.

And move up, Olivia did. Recently, the G4 host landed a stint with Playboy, that magazine that shows women’s private bits. What made Olivia’s pictorial special (or controversial, depending on how you see it) is that she didn’t bare anything compromising.

You read that right—there is no nudity in Olivia Munn’s Playboy pictorial. A rarity indeed.

You certainly can’t blame Playboy for trying. Despite having agreed that Munn won’t be shot in the nude, Playboy’s photographers kept egging the starlet to wear outfits that leave nothing to the imagination. Olivia told Kotaku that the issue ended with her publicist and stylist “screaming at each other.”

Here’s the crappy part: the issue isn’t about Olivia not wanting to reveal her girly parts. In fact, I commend her for sticking to her guns despite the perseverance of Playboy’s stylists to get her naked. But here’s the problem: the pictorial is for Playboy.

Playboy has been showing pictures of naked women for the past 55 years. I don’t think I need to get into the magazine’s history, but you should at least be aware of what the publication does. If Olivia didn’t want to pose nude, she shouldn’t have done a pictorial with Playboy.

If Olivia Munn would insist on getting some coverage on Playboy, then an interview should be enough.

The whole deal stinks of shameless self-promotion on Munn’s part. She wants the spotlight, to show that she’s cover girl material, that she’s not limited to Attack of the Show. Nothing wrong with that, right? Of course!

However, deceiving people for shameless self-promotion on Playboy, for taking advantage of a demographic (i.e. millions of young male gamers/techies) that would be drooling over the idea of a nude Olivia Munn is downright loathsome. Munn’s self-promotion is as shameless as Kim Kardashian’s attention-seeking shenanigans.

So Olivia, props to you for sticking to your guns. Just pick a more appropriate venue for shameless self-promotion the next time.
